A dairy farm between Douglas and Renfrew was destroyed Sunday afternoon by fire.

It started at the Enright Dairy Farm located near Cheese Factory Road at 12:40 p.m. and quickly spread requiring the help of three fire departments to get it under the control.

The fire left some of the 135 cattle dead and others stranded in the field with no where to go. The silos at the Enright Dairy Farm are also at risk of toppling over because they are so heavily damaged.

There is no word as to how the fire started or the estimated cost of the damage.
